Shin Kong Financial Holding Co Ltd (2888) — Long-term Investment Intensity

Latest as of March 2025: 67.8%

Shin Kong Financial Holding Co Ltd (2888) has a Long-term Investment Intensity of 67.8% as of March 2025. Long-term investments of NT$3.52 Trillion represent 67.8% of total assets of NT$5.19 Trillion. A higher ratio indicates a company with significant capital committed to long-duration strategic positions. See 2888 net assets for net asset value and shareholders' equity analysis.

Annual Long-term Investment Intensity for Shin Kong Financial Holding Co Ltd (2013–2024)

The table below presents the year-by-year Long-term Investment Intensity for Shin Kong Financial Holding Co Ltd from 2013 to 2024, covering 12 annual filings. Each row shows total assets, long-term investments, the intensity percentage, and the change in percentage points compared to the prior year. Year LT Investment Intensity LT Investments (TWD) Total Assets Change (pp)
2024 67.1% NT$3.45 Trillion NT$5.14 Trillion ▼ -0.1 pp
2023 67.3% NT$3.33 Trillion NT$4.95 Trillion ▼ -1.5 pp
2022 68.8% NT$3.34 Trillion NT$4.85 Trillion ▲ +0.2 pp
2021 68.6% NT$3.21 Trillion NT$4.69 Trillion ▲ +0.9 pp
2020 67.7% NT$2.95 Trillion NT$4.36 Trillion ▲ +1.6 pp
2019 66.2% NT$2.63 Trillion NT$3.98 Trillion ▼ -2.5 pp
2018 68.7% NT$2.51 Trillion NT$3.65 Trillion ▲ +2.7 pp
2017 66.0% NT$2.23 Trillion NT$3.38 Trillion ▲ +2.8 pp
2016 63.2% NT$2.00 Trillion NT$3.16 Trillion ▲ +8.7 pp
2015 54.5% NT$1.61 Trillion NT$2.96 Trillion ▲ +2.2 pp
2014 52.2% NT$1.46 Trillion NT$2.80 Trillion ▼ -0.7 pp
2013 52.9% NT$1.34 Trillion NT$2.54 Trillion
pp = percentage points
